Ishpeming, Michigan – December 29th, 2015 – Mike Plourde and Bob Nadeau were in Ishpeming, MI for the Ishpeming Hematites boys first game of the season against the Westwood Patriots on 98.3 WRUP and WRUP.com. The Hematites looked to start their season strong, and Mike and Bob brought you their stats and predictions during the Honor Credit Union pregame show!
It was sure to be a tough game for both teams, but the Ishpeming Hematites got off to a great start when their first points of the game was a long three-point basket. The score remained tight through the first half of the opening quarter, and the Patriots and Hematites traded the lead back and forth. Luke Kuliu played some great defense, and he had a great steal which shut down Westwood’s momentum late in the quarter. Ozzy Corp had a great blocked shot just before the end of the quarter, and the score was tied 16-16 as the buzzer sounded.
The Westwood Patriots inbounded the ball to start the second quarter, but the Ishpeming Hematites were the first to put points on the board in the quarter. Hart Holmgren scored his second three pointer of the game midway through the second, after he rejected a shot attempt from the Patriots and wrangled the loose ball himself. Ishpeming managed to pull out a small lead before the first half ended, and Thomas Finegan’s great passing helped them secure the lead going into the second half of play.
First Half Score:
Ishpeming Hematites: 33
Westwood Patriots: 25
The Ishpeming Hematite boys’ first game of the season continued to be close, and the start of the third quarter saw the Hematites take the opening tip-off and score on a quick jump shot. Ishpeming’s lead continued to be narrow throughout much of the third quarter, but their defense continued to keep them in the lead. Fouls began to be a problem for the Hematites late in the third, but they managed to keep their lead until the end of the third quarter with a score of 47-42.
The Ishpeming Hematites brought the ball inbounds to begin the fourth quarter, and they were immediately able to increase their lead after a short jump shot. The Westwood Patriots brought the score to within four points with five minutes left in the fourth quarter, but they began to appear worn down. With just under four minutes left in the game, the score was 50-44 in favor of Ishpeming, and that lead was increased when Jaren Kipling nailed a three point shot and made the free throw after he was fouled on the shot. The Hematites continued to play well on defense, and that helped hold Ishpeming’s lead as the game wound down.
Final Game Score:
Ishpeming Hematites: 60
Westwood Patriots: 57
